Is 160 511 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 160 511 is about 400.638.

Thus, the square root of 160 511 is not an integer, and therefore 160 511 is not a square number.

What is the square number of 160 511?

The square of a number (here 160 511) is the result of the product of this number (160 511) by itself (i.e., 160 511 × 160 511); the square of 160 511 is sometimes called "raising 160 511 to the power 2", or "160 511 squared".

The square of 160 511 is 25 763 781 121 because 160 511 × 160 511 = 160 5112 = 25 763 781 121.

As a consequence, 160 511 is the square root of 25 763 781 121.
